Privacy
Terms
Reactions
Entertainment
Sports
Stickers
Artists
Upload
Create
Log In
National Kidney Foundation
@NationalKidneyFoundation
Fueled by passion and urgency, the National Kidney Foundation is a lifeline for all people affected by kidney disease.
Read More ▾
Source
Report
Embed
Info
#
flu shot
#
flushot
#
nkf
#
kidney disease
...
Use Our App
602,385
Views